Dead Key Fob Battery

If you click the fob of your key on your car to lock or unlock, and nothing happens, it's likely that you have a dead cell. Fob batteries vary in lifespan however, they typically last between three and four years with regular usage. If you have a spare key fob on to hand, changing the battery is an easy and easy fix.

One of the most frequent signs of a dying fob battery is having to press your fob several times in order to get it to work. A working fob needs only one click to unlock and lock your car. If you're needing to press your fob repeatedly again, this is a good indication that it's time to replace the battery.

You can purchase replacement fob batteries at any auto parts store or online. They will be marked as CR2025 or CR2032. You can pry the battery compartment of your fob open with a small screw that is usually included with a new battery. After opening your fob take the emergency key out and gently push or pull along the seam that separates top and bottom halves. Take out the old battery and then insert the new one, snapping the fob back to its original position.

Once you have replaced the battery, ensure that the (+) and the (-) sides are facing the buttons. Test all the remote buttons to verify that they're functioning properly.

Broken Key Fob

The key fob is an intricate piece of technology with a lot going on inside. It's responsible for communicating with your car and transmitting the right signals when you press buttons. If something goes wrong, your car may respond in an unexpected manner or not at all.

Check the battery first to determine if the key fob you have isn't working. It is possible to change the batteries on most fobs. You can find replacements in supermarkets, pharmacies, and anyplace you purchase batteries. If you replace the battery and your key fob doesn't function, it might be best to take it into an expert mechanic for further testing.

Another reason that the reason your key fob isn't working is because it is no longer paired with your vehicle. Each time you press a button on the fob it transmits a unique code to your car that informs it whether or not to unlock the doors or start the engine. The fob will cease to function if it is no longer recognized by your vehicle. It is necessary to re-program it.
